Facts about Ngedebus Coral Gardens
  • It is in Palau
  • Ngedebus Coral Gardens is in the Pacific.
  • The typical depth is 0-50 Metres 0-160 Feet.
  • The typical visibility is 10-30 Metres 30-100 Feet.
